Inventory in Carpinteria has expanded on a rolling three-month basis, with active listings up about 20% year over year. New listings have risen nearly 30% over the same period, while homes sold have surged more than 45%, showing that additional supply is being quickly absorbed. Pending sales are also up by roughly 32% from a year ago, underscoring steady contract activity.

Pricing is adjusting alongside this stronger flow of homes. The typical home value over the latest three-month window is down about 19% year over year, even as the median list price has climbed roughly 7%, suggesting sellers are testing higher ask prices while buyers negotiate more firmly. Despite that pullback in sale prices, the average sale-to-list ratio sits just above 100%, indicating that many homes still close near or slightly above asking.

Homes are moving at a brisker pace than last year, with median days on market at 33 days and down sharply in the rolling annual comparison. Months of supply has dropped to 2.4 and is significantly lower than a year ago, reinforcing Carpinteria’s status as a seller’s market. About one-third of recent sales closed above list price, and more than half of homes went off market within two weeks, reflecting solid buyer demand. Learn more about what Carpinteria has to offer.

Carpinteria offers residents a relaxed coastal lifestyle with beautiful beaches, abundant outdoor spaces, a tight-knit community, and a thriving local scene of shops and eateries.

Carpinteria offers a quieter, small-town alternative to nearby Santa Barbara and Ventura, with a strong local identity shaped by agricultural roots and a low-key beach culture. Residents enjoy walkable neighborhoods that connect easily to Carpinteria State Beach, downtown shops, and family-owned restaurants along Linden Avenue. The community is close-knit, with long-term residents, surf families, and remote professionals sharing the same laid-back pace of life.

Outdoor access defines daily living here. Locals hike the coastal bluffs on the Carpinteria Bluffs Nature Preserve, watch seals at the rookery, or take kids to play at Tar Pits Park. Coffee meetups often happen at Lucky Llama Coffee House, while community events gather around the Carpinteria Community Library and annual festivals. Families value the local schools, supported by the Carpinteria Unified School District, and the easy train connection at Carpinteria Station makes regional commuting more manageable.
